EVELYN So the plan to have a chill night outside was a fail. By the time Lionel dropped me off at home, my headache had doubled. Between stabbing a man, seeing Arthur, and having him openly question Toby’s paternity in the middle of a nightclub, I was dangerously close to losing whatever remained of my sanity. The second I stepped through the front door, I kicked off my heels and let out a long breath. Thankfully, Toby was already asleep by the time I got home. I stood in his doorway for a few minutes, watching him sleep. His blanket was half-kicked off the bed, one sock was missing from his legs, and his stuffed dinosaur was lying face-down on the floor.
